							- // Custom .ini file access caching layer for minIni.
 
- // This reduces boot delay by only reading the ini file once
 
- // after boot or SD-card removal.
 
- #include <minGlue.h>
 
- #include <SdFat.h>
 
- // This can be overridden in platformio.ini
 
- // Set to 0 to disable the cache.
 
- #ifndef INI_CACHE_SIZE
 
- #define INI_CACHE_SIZE 4096
 
- #endif
 
- // Use the SdFs instance from main program
 
- extern SdFs SD;
 
- static struct {
 
-     bool valid;
 
-     INI_FILETYPE *fp;
 
- #if INI_CACHE_SIZE > 0
 
-     const char *filename;
 
-     uint32_t filelen;
 
-     INI_FILEPOS current_pos;
 
-     char cachedata[INI_CACHE_SIZE];
 
- #endif
 
- } g_ini_cache;
 
- // Invalidate any cached file contents
 
- void invalidate_ini_cache()
 
- {
 
-     g_ini_cache.valid = false;
 
-     g_ini_cache.fp = NULL;
 
- }
 
- // Read the config file into RAM
 
- void reload_ini_cache(const char *filename)
 
- {
 
-     g_ini_cache.valid = false;
 
-     g_ini_cache.fp = NULL;
 
- #if INI_CACHE_SIZE > 0
 
-     g_ini_cache.filename = filename;
 
-     FsFile config = SD.open(filename, O_RDONLY);
 
-     g_ini_cache.filelen = config.fileSize();
 
-     if (config.isOpen() && g_ini_cache.filelen <= INI_CACHE_SIZE)
 
-     {
 
-         if (config.read(g_ini_cache.cachedata, g_ini_cache.filelen) == g_ini_cache.filelen)
 
-         {
 
-             g_ini_cache.valid = true;
 
-         }
 
-     }
 
-     config.close();
 
- #endif
 
- }
 
- // Open .ini file either from cache or from SD card
 
- bool ini_openread(const char *filename, INI_FILETYPE *fp)
 
- {
 
- #if INI_CACHE_SIZE > 0
 
-     if (g_ini_cache.valid &&
 
-         (filename == g_ini_cache.filename || strcmp(filename, g_ini_cache.filename) == 0))
 
-     {
 
-         fp->close();
 
-         g_ini_cache.fp = fp;
 
-         g_ini_cache.current_pos.position = 0;
 
-         return true;
 
-     }
 
- #endif
 
-     return fp->open(SD.vol(), filename, O_RDONLY);
 
- }
 
- // Close previously opened file
 
- bool ini_close(INI_FILETYPE *fp)
 
- {
 
- #if INI_CACHE_SIZE > 0
 
-     if (g_ini_cache.fp == fp)
 
-     {
 
-         g_ini_cache.fp = NULL;
 
-         return true;
 
-     }
 
-     else
 
- #endif
 
-     {
 
-         return fp->close();
 
-     }
 
- }
 
- // Read a single line from cache or from SD card
 
- bool ini_read(char *buffer, int size, INI_FILETYPE *fp)
 
- {
 
- #if INI_CACHE_SIZE > 0
 
-     if (g_ini_cache.fp == fp)
 
-     {
 
-         // Read one line from cache
 
-         uint32_t srcpos = g_ini_cache.current_pos.position;
 
-         int dstpos = 0;
 
-         while (srcpos < g_ini_cache.filelen &&
 
-                dstpos < size - 1)
 
-         {
 
-             char b = g_ini_cache.cachedata[srcpos++];
 
-             buffer[dstpos++] = b;
 
-             if (b == '\n') break;
 
-         }
 
-         buffer[dstpos] = 0;
 
-         g_ini_cache.current_pos.position = srcpos;
 
-         return dstpos > 0;
 
-     }
 
-     else
 
- #endif
 
-     {
 
-         // Read from SD card
 
-         return fp->fgets(buffer, size) > 0;
 
-     }
 
- }
 
- // Get the position inside the file
 
- void ini_tell(INI_FILETYPE *fp, INI_FILEPOS *pos)
 
- {
 
- #if INI_CACHE_SIZE > 0
 
-     if (g_ini_cache.fp == fp)
 
-     {
 
-         *pos = g_ini_cache.current_pos;
 
-     }
 
-     else
 
- #endif
 
-     {
 
-         fp->fgetpos(pos);
 
-     }
 
- }
 
- // Go back to previously saved position
 
- void ini_seek(INI_FILETYPE *fp, INI_FILEPOS *pos)
 
- {
 
- #if INI_CACHE_SIZE > 0
 
-     if (g_ini_cache.fp == fp)
 
-     {
 
-         g_ini_cache.current_pos = *pos;
 
-     }
 
-     else
 
- #endif
 
-     {
 
-         fp->fsetpos(pos);
 
-     }
 
- }
